Notes, Skarnwell security triage. Image cache in the Pellbrook viewer leaks decoded bitmaps on rotation; eviction callback never fires when the activity restarts. Memory climbs ~40MB per rotation. No data exposure identified, but OOM crashes could drop audit logging mid-session. Fix targeted for the next point release. Remediation and verification are assigned to:

approver of bagug-bagag = Holael Pramir

Subject: Basement archive room — access

New starters: the archive room is in Basement Level 1 at Grayhollow House, past the plant room. Hours are 09:00–17:00 weekdays. Sign the ledger by the door every visit. No food, no bags. Your badge opens the stairwell only; the archive door itself takes the keypad code below.

staff pass of kawip-hawef = bdg-QLP-2

**Ticket: Signature verification fails on waveform preview plugin**

Several external authors report that the Soundquill host rejects the audio waveform preview module with a signature mismatch after last week's SDK update. The verifier now requires signatures produced against the v3 manifest format; plugins signed under v2 will fail even if the binary is unchanged. Please re-sign your build using the v3 toolchain before resubmitting. For verification, the host checks against the current plugin signing key, reproduced below.

rollout seal: bky4_x7Gc

## Deployment

The Lumacache image service has a known slow leak in its thumbnail cache layer: evicted entries keep a reference alive through the decoder pool, so resident memory creeps up roughly 40 MB per hour under steady load. Until the refactor in the Harkness branch lands, we mitigate by capping pool size and scheduling a rolling restart every 12 hours. Deploy with the supervisor, never bare, or the restart hook won't fire. The deployment relies on the configuration values listed below.

settings of bagug-tahof:
holath:
  pin: 7837
  metrics_host: metrics.holath.tolvaqsys.internal
  tenant: quenath
  seal: seal_6001b3af